Thaksin to teach at Japanese universityThailand's ousted former prime minister, Thaksin Shinawatra, will become a guest professor at Tokyo's Takushoku University and hold a special class on July 5, sources close to him said Thursday.
Thaksin's acquaintances in Japan have made arrangements for the post out of hope his wide-ranging knowledge will be passed on to Japan's younger generation, they said. In the special class, he is expected to give a lecture on Asian business-economic models, based on his experience as a businessman before he went into politics, they said.
Thaksin plans to visit Japan in early June to hold discussions with officials of the university and hold a press conference in Tokyo with university President Toshio Watanabe to announce his taking the post of guest professor, according to the sources.
He assumed the post of Thai prime minister in February 2001 but was ousted in a coup last September while he was in the United States. He has since been outside Thailand in a de facto asylum in London, Beijing and elsewhere.
